Week 13 AFC East game picks: Cardinals at Jets

Lead writer Nick St. Denis and AFC East Daily contributors Dan Begnoche and Sean Donovan pick the New York Jets' home bout with the NFC's Arizona Cardinals.

Nick's take:
The Jets stink as of late, but there are worse teams. The Cardinals are one of them. Arizona is down to its third-string quarterback, a rookie sixth-rounder named Ryan Lindley, and his four-interception debut last week didn't breath much life into a team that has lost seven straight after a 4-0 start. Arizona will play scared on offense, and its top-teir pass defense will go to waste against a Jets offense that won't need to throw the ball a whole lot.
Prediction: Jets 24, Cardinals 6

Sean's take:
The Jets can't seem to catch a break these days. Luckily, this week they get a visit from an Arizona team averaging just 16.4 points per game, which is next-to-last in the NFL. If Rex Ryan stays true to his roots of aggressive defense and his offense stays at least a little stable in this one, it should be a comfortable win for Gang Green.
Prediction: Jets 21, Cardinals 3

Dan's take:
Despite last week's embarrassment at the hands of the Patriots, the Jets' schedule looks promising for a turnaround, starting with the Cardinals, who have shown little sign of slowing their own tailspin. Lindley makes his second start Sunday after an abysmal game last week, and with a rushing attack that's been near invisible, New York should breeze through this one. That's of course if Ryan and his team can get their turnover situation under control.
Prediction: Jets 27, Cardinals 13
